Abstract:
The implementation of procedures used to calculate the attitude of a rocket from its transmitted gyroscopic roll, pitch, and yaw signals is discussed. The differences and the angular conversions of the output from various inertial attitude systems are presented. Also, a synopsis of the mathematical analysis used to compute attitude is presented. In addition, analyses and data reduction techniques are developed to determine the attitude of the Ute-Tomahawk rocket A09.209-1, fired 16 April 1973 at White Sands Missile Range, New Mexico.
